Output b59fba4c326086662e4b3c925d0bac323499110d7acda4812626bcc002e9cfcb:0

value
85000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669e244bb52e84caf63ac8ffe6750aad17306e7c OP_EQUAL
address
3B3cHzbzJu4Y5FUmZdBkFJ9EvYy75WpU81
transaction
b59fba4c326086662e4b3c925d0bac323499110d7acda4812626bcc002e9cfcb